Joseph Stock (born 1789-died 30 October 1855) was an Irish Whig politician, barrister, Law Officer and judge. He was Serjeant-at-law and served as the Admiralty judge 1838-1855. He was one of the ten children of Joseph Stock, Bishop of Killala and Achonry and his first wife Catherine Palmer (née Newcome) widow of Patrick Palmer and sister of William Newcome, Archbishop of Armagh. He lived at Temple Street, Dublin. He never married, and at his death, his substantial fortune was divided between his relatives.
